TYPES OF DATA TRANSFER CONNECTORS OR CHARGING CONNECTORS

DIFFERENT TYPES OF DATA TRANSFER CONNECTOR

We are using mobile phones since so many years. And we saw different types of data transfer cables or pins or ports, which helps us to transfer data or charge battery. But, do you know how fast they transfer data.

In this blog I will explain transfer speed of particular cable and 6 different types of data transfer cables available in market. 

1. USB Small Pin
2. USB Mini-B 4 Pin
3. USB Mini-B 5 Pin
4. USB Lightning
5. USB Micro Flat Pin
6. USB Type-C

1. USB SMALL PIN (2mm pin) 

This pin was quite famous in India as Nokia charging pin. Nokia use to bundle small pin charger with all the devices they launched. With this pin technology was only used to charge mobile phones, but data transfer experience was not good. Or may be at that period of time not many people were in technology like, to transfer files into computer and again transfer back all that stuff. I don't have exact theoretical number of transfer speed but it was lot more slow compare to other next generation pins.

2. USB MINI-B 4 PIN
The mini-b 4 pin only supports USB 2.0, which transfers data at the speed of 480Mbps. This was not so popular in India. I saw less mobile phones which comes with this port.

3. USB MINI-B 5 PIN
It was a slight improved version of mini 4pin USB. But it gives a strong fight to small pin which 4 pin was failed to do. This connector has more technology. It was used for charging and as well as transfer data from any portable device into computer. It makes data transformation between devices easier. It also supports USB 2.0 only but transfer speed was slightly improved, which is 500Mbps. 

4. LIGHTNING CONNECTOR 
Lightning connector also support USB 2.0 which transfers data at 480Mbps speed. For some devices it supports USB 3.0 also. Apple is the company which bundles lightning connector with their devices like iPhone, iPad etc. Apple customers always had a complaint about slow charging speed for their devices.

5. MICRO USB 3.0
Micro USB connector supports USB 3.0 which transfers data upto 5Gbps. Can you see the difference, it is 10times more faster than the connectors which support USB 2.0. This was the huge implementation. All the companies ship their smartphones with Micro USB port, which supports charging as well as transfer data between devices very fast.
 
6. USB 3.1 TYPE-C

From Micro USB 3.0 to Type-C connector, the speed increased by twice. It transfers data at the speed upto 10Gbps and it supports USB 3.1. This speed is achieved by the design also. This technology is available from long time but not many brands include this port because of cost. The cost of this connector is high. But now slowly all the companies are shifting to Type-C. Like Apple and many more companies now they are launching laptops with Type-C port. In future Type-C can be a universal port which will be better option.
